راهنمای گام به گام برای توسعه دهندگان وب
Vue.js یک فریم ورک جاوااسکریپت پیشرو برای ساخت رابط کاربری (UI) و برنامه های تک صفحه ای (SPA) است. با Vue.js، می توانید به سرعت و به آسانی رابط های کاربری واکنش گرا، کارآمد و قابل نگهداری ایجاد کنید. Vue.js به دلیل سادگی، انعطاف پذیری و عملکرد بالا، انتخاب محبوبی بین توسعه دهندگان وب است.
این فریم ورک، برخلاف فریم ورک هایی مانند Angular و React، رویکردی تدریجی دارد، به این معنی که می توانید به آسانی آن را در پروژه های موجود ادغام کنید یا از آن برای ساخت برنامه های پیچیده از ابتدا استفاده نمایید. Vue.js با بهره گیری از سیستم کامپوننت، توسعه را سازماندهی کرده و امکان استفاده مجدد از کدها را فراهم می کند.
برای شروع یادگیری Vue.js، شما به دانش پایه ای از HTML، CSS و JavaScript نیاز دارید. همچنین، آشنایی با مفاهیم DOM و ES6 می تواند مفید باشد.
شما می توانید Vue.js را به روش های مختلفی نصب و راه اندازی کنید:
<script src="https://cdn.jsdelivr.net/npm/vue@2"></script>
npm install vue
npm install -g @vue/cli
vue create my-project
Vue.js دارای مفاهیم کلیدی متعددی است که درک آن ها برای توسعه برنامه های وب با این فریم ورک ضروری است. برخی از مهم ترین این مفاهیم عبارتند از:
در این قسمت، یک کامپوننت ساده Vue.js را ایجاد می کنیم:
<div id="app">
<p>{{ message }}</p>
</div>
<script>
var app = new Vue({
el: '#app',
data: {
message: 'سلام، Vue.js!'
}
})
</script>
در این مثال، یک کامپوننت Vue.js با یک ویژگی داده به نام `message` ایجاد کرده ایم. مقدار این ویژگی در تمپلیت با استفاده از `{{ message }}` نمایش داده می شود.
در این قسمت، چند مثال عملی از کاربرد Vue.js را بررسی می کنیم: